    If the names; "Cowboy" Jimmy Moore, "King" Frank Oliva or Mr. William (Willie) Frederick Hoppe mean…read moreanything to you, you are apparently an aficionado of the sport of kings. Not the one with the roses and 4 hoofed animals, the one with the green - Billiard Table Green (felt that is). If you are interested in expanding your knowledge of the history and pursuit of the sport of pocket billiards, look no further. One of the most unique places you will find is right here, quietly existing in Willow Springs on the North side of Archer Avenue. You have probably driven past it hundreds of times. Filled with photos and memorabilia of the sport, site of numerous championships, visits from famous billiard wizards, home of antique (priceless) billiard tables, wholesome meals, and wonderful beyond words owners, I give you the Illinois Billiard Club/ aka / Jim and Bonnie's, Jim and Bonnie Parker, Proprietors. From their website: "Today, as the oldest, most historically elegant, individually founded, owned and operated private billiard club in North America, the IBC and Bonnie's Dining & Banquets invite today's 21st century society to enjoy a fine meal, and, the fun filled game of billiards ... all presented within the charm, tranquility and grandeur of their 19th century country home" The IBC is a private club that, for a limited time (effective February 2010) opens its doors at 5pm every Friday and Saturday evening serving dinner and allowing you to check out their billiards tables without membership. Dinner reservations are suggested. Their website: www.illinoisbilliardclub.com There is a lot of information on the sport and on the facility. Jim and Bonnie's provides catering and the facility is available for events. We hold our annual Christmas party here and the space along with the food and service make the event quite special and memorable. Check out the wedding pics on the website. If you can convince your betrothed that this is the place to hold your wedding reception - invite me for giving you the advice. If you visit in the near future, talk to Jim in regards to membership in the IBC. I understand that there are some slots open. If you enjoy billiards, the cost is minimal in regards to the quality of the tables, food and camaraderie you will find here. Note that this is NOT a pool hall bar; this is a first class, family run, private facility for people serious about the sport (which also happens to function as a restaurant in order to market their services). If you are in that "serious about the sport" category, it is more than worth a visit.
